Transaction fcaa837cddc211564607140aab3a28e3aadfd819e07b898a2bab18d959419cae
1 Input
1 Output
-
fcaa837cddc211564607140aab3a28e3aadfd819e07b898a2bab18d959419cae:0
- value
- 1581709
- script pubkey
- OP_0 OP_PUSHBYTES_20 188e75946a5064d8f56c63b3ed7ade3cd36155d4
- address
- bc1qrz88t9r22pjd3atvvwe767k78nfkz4w5ngu3ny